Understanding the Metric: What’s Ft Per Second?

Earlier than we will precisely focus on the speed of a 9mm bullet, we have to grasp the basic unit of measurement: Ft Per Second (FPS). It’s the gold customary for quantifying the velocity of a bullet, defining how far a projectile travels in a single second. Merely put, FPS is the gap, in ft, a bullet covers in a single second of its flight. The upper the FPS, the sooner the bullet travels.

The relevance of FPS transcends mere measurement. It’s integral to understanding a bullet’s trajectory, its power, and, finally, its effectiveness. A bullet’s FPS immediately correlates with its kinetic power – the power of movement. A faster-moving bullet possesses extra kinetic power, which interprets to higher potential for impression and penetration. FPS is the important thing metric for estimating a bullet’s vary, the gap it is going to journey earlier than gravity brings it down. Correct ballistics calculations, important for goal taking pictures and self-defense, are closely reliant on figuring out the bullet’s FPS.

The method for figuring out a bullet’s FPS is exact. Ballistic scientists and gun fans use a tool referred to as a chronograph. This gadget makes use of digital sensors to measure the time a bullet takes to journey a recognized distance, permitting for exact FPS calculations. The reliability of the chronograph is essential; it have to be calibrated and used accurately to supply correct knowledge.

The Common Flight Path: Demystifying the Pace of 9mm Ammunition

The 9mm Luger, often known as 9x19mm Parabellum, is a ubiquitous cartridge, famed for its versatility. Due to its widespread use, a considerable amount of ballistic knowledge for 9mm ammunition is out there. The FPS of a 9mm bullet is not a single, static quantity. It varies relying on a number of elements, nevertheless, there are frequent ranges.

Typically, you’ll be able to count on a 9mm bullet to journey at speeds wherever from a decrease vary. Many customary manufacturing unit hundreds will produce velocities which might be barely increased. The precise FPS will fluctuate with the bullet’s weight and the kind of propellant used, so figuring out the precise ammunition is crucial for correct estimates.

The 9mm makes use of quite a lot of bullet weights, every impacting the FPS. The basic 9mm projectiles, and people sometimes used for follow, are the 115-grain bullets. These lighter bullets typically have increased FPS due to their decrease mass. Heavier bullets like 147-grain 9mm rounds are slower.

The particular FPS of a 9mm bullet will rely on the ammunition producer and the precise load. Excessive-performance ammunition, usually designated as “+P” (Plus-P) or “+P+” (Plus-P-Plus), incorporates the next propellant cost, which is created to ship the next FPS, however the further efficiency additionally means the next strain.

The Influencing Forces: Elements that Shift Velocity

Whereas there are frequent FPS ranges for the 9mm bullet, a number of circumstances can impression the projectile’s velocity. It is very important perceive these components to understand the complexities of ballistics totally.

One of many essential elements is the size of the barrel. Merely put, the longer the barrel, the higher the chance for the increasing gases to propel the bullet, and the upper the FPS. A handgun with a shorter barrel, like those frequent in hid carry, will ship a decrease FPS than a pistol or rifle with an extended barrel. For instance, the distinction in FPS between a 3-inch barrel and a 5-inch barrel may be fairly noticeable, resulting in efficiency variations by way of vary and effectiveness.

The particular sort of ammunition you utilize performs a major position. Not all 9mm cartridges are created equal. Full Metallic Jacket (FMJ) bullets, generally used for goal follow as a consequence of their decrease value, will behave in another way from Jacketed Hole Level (JHP) bullets, particularly designed for self-defense. Larger-quality, self-defense hundreds usually have barely increased FPS as a consequence of their design and propellant. Additionally, the model of ammunition you select impacts the speed, as producers use proprietary strategies to develop and take a look at their projectiles.

The kind of gunpowder propellant can be a substantial variable. The traits of the powder, together with its burn charge and composition, will considerably impression how shortly the gases construct strain inside the case, propelling the bullet down the barrel. Smokeless powders are the most typical propellant sort, and inside this class, there’s a variety of powder formulations. Every sort of powder is personalized to a selected bullet weight.

Environmental elements additionally play a small position. Temperature can have an effect on the efficiency of the propellant, with hotter temperatures doubtlessly resulting in barely increased FPS. These variations, nevertheless, are normally small.

Penetration and Effectiveness: The Relationship Between Pace and Efficiency

The 9mm bullet’s FPS isn’t merely a technical specification; it has direct implications for its real-world efficiency. A bullet’s velocity is a significant determinant of its penetration, its functionality to journey via a goal. Larger FPS usually means higher penetration.

The kinetic power of a bullet at impression is important in figuring out the injury it inflicts. The sooner the bullet and the heavier the bullet, the higher the impression. The design of the bullet additionally comes into play. For instance, JHP bullets, particularly designed to broaden upon impression, will create a wider wound channel, transferring extra of their power to the goal.

Moreover, the speed impacts the bullet’s trajectory. The upper the FPS, the flatter the trajectory – the much less the bullet will drop over a given distance. A flatter trajectory simplifies aiming, particularly at longer ranges. Understanding the trajectory is essential for correct shot placement, whether or not in goal taking pictures or self-defense.
